Some of the hundreds of people looking to escape found some of the emergency exit doors either blocked or locked.

Gardaí have said they are still “actively pursuing” a review into the deaths of 48 people in the Stardust nightclub in north Dublin, as Saturday marks the 45th anniversary of the tragedy.

In a statement, An Garda Síochána said its Serious Crime Review Team at the Garda National Bureau of Criminal Investigation is continuing its work on the fire almost two years after the review was ordered following inquest verdicts that all of the young people who died were “unlawfully killed”.
